2005 Ferrari Maranello vs. 1960 Moretti 1200

To start off, 2005 Ferrari Maranello is newer by 45 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1960 Moretti 1200.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1960 Moretti 1200 would be higher. At 5,997 cc (12 cylinders), 2005 Ferrari Maranello is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Ferrari Maranello (508 HP) has 453 more horse power than 1960 Moretti 1200. (55 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Ferrari Maranello should accelerate faster than 1960 Moretti 1200.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Ferrari Maranello weights approximately 695 kg more than 1960 Moretti 1200.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Ferrari Maranello 1960 Moretti 1200
Make Ferrari Moretti
Model Maranello 1200
Year Released 2005 1960
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5997 cc 1204 cc
Engine Cylinders 12 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 508 HP 55 HP
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 1675 kg 980 kg
Vehicle Length 4560 mm 4260 mm
Vehicle Width 1950 mm 1610 mm
Vehicle Height 1290 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 2510 mm 2360 mm
